"The Book of Roman Pop-up Board Games" by Sadie Fields takes readers on an interactive journey through the playful world of ancient Rome. This unique book features stunning pop-up elements that bring to life various board games enjoyed by Romans, including strategy and chance games that reflect their culture. Readers can not only explore the rules and history behind these games but also engage in hands-on play. With vibrant illustrations and informative text, this book offers both a historical experience and a chance to participate in the fun, making it an exciting resource for game enthusiasts and history buffs alike.
